need diagram and tips for changing water pump in 1994 Dodge Ram VAN B350

Its pretty straight forward. Borrow the fan clutch tool from a local parts store. Lay the new pump out on a table and stick the bolts in the corresponding holes as you remove them from the original pump, so you dont mix them up. Vasoline always helps when reinstalling the rubber hoses. Dont just fill the coolant reservoir and start it up. Let the air bubble up through the reservoir and slowly add coolant.
